Compatibility and Use Cases

The GeeekPi power supply is specifically designed for Raspberry Pi models, including the Raspberry Pi 4, 3B+, and 3B, as well as Orange Pi 5 and 5B. This makes it an excellent choice for hobbyists and developers working on projects with these devices. In contrast, the PCCOOLER power supply targets a broader audience, being fully modular and compliant with ATX 3.1 specifications. This feature makes it ideal for high-performance gaming PCs and workstations, where compatibility with the latest components is crucial.

Power Output and Efficiency

The GeeekPi power supply provides a power output of 5V and 4A, translating to a total of 20W, which is sufficient for the devices it supports. On the other hand, the PCCOOLER PSU boasts an 80 Plus Gold certification, delivering up to 92% conversion efficiency under typical loads. This means that while the GeeekPi is designed for low power requirements, the PCCOOLER excels in efficiency, making it a better choice for users who demand high performance and lower energy costs.

Design and Build Quality

In terms of design, the GeeekPi power supply comes with an ON/OFF switch, adding convenience for users who wish to easily control their device’s power. It also features professional certifications like UL, TUV, and RoHS, ensuring a degree of safety and reliability. Conversely, the PCCOOLER PSU’s fully modular design allows users to connect only the cables they need, enhancing airflow and reducing clutter. It is built with premium Japanese capacitors for long-term stability, making it a durable option for demanding environments.

Cooling and Noise Levels

Cooling is another critical factor in power supply performance. The GeeekPi power supply does not provide specific information about its cooling features, which may be a consideration for users operating in warmer environments. In contrast, the PCCOOLER PSU includes a temperature-controlled 120mm hydraulic bearing fan that operates quietly at low loads but ramps up under heavy demand. This smart cooling system ensures efficient operation without excessive noise, appealing to gamers and professionals who prefer a quieter workspace.

Protection Features

Protection features are essential for safeguarding your devices against power issues. The GeeekPi power supply offers multiple protection functions, including overvoltage, undervoltage, over temperature, over current, and short circuit protection. These features provide peace of mind for users concerned about the safety of their Raspberry Pi devices. Meanwhile, the PCCOOLER PSU includes comprehensive protection features such as overvoltage protection (OVP), undervoltage protection (UVP), over power protection (OPP), short circuit protection (SCP), and over temperature protection (OTP). This extensive range of safety measures makes it a robust choice for high-end systems.
